The estate has been in the Gayraud family since 1920 and is currently managed by Lise and Benjamin Gayraud, who represent the fourth generation of winemakers. Their vineyards sit on the oldest terraces of the Lot, where the limestone-rich clay soil provides a perfect foundation for Malbec. The family maintains a deep respect for the land, utilizing sustainable farming practices to ensure the long-term health of their unique terroir.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-path-to-node=\"1\"\u003eThe 2019 vintage showcases the estate's ability to balance the natural power of the Malbec grape with a sense of refinement. After a careful harvest, the grapes undergo a traditional fermentation followed by aging in a combination of oak barrels and concrete tanks. This method preserves the vibrant fruit character while allowing the tannins to soften and integrate.
